The Women's 200 metre breaststroke competition at the 2024 World Aquatics Championships was held on 15 and 16 February 2024. [1] [2]

Contents

Records

Prior to the competition, the existing world and championship records were as follows. [3]

World record Flag of Russia.svg  Evgeniia Chikunova  (RUS)2:17.55 Kazan, Russia21 April 2023
Competition recordFlag of Denmark.svg  Rikke Møller Pedersen  (DEN)2:19.11 Barcelona, Spain1 August 2013

Final

The final was held on 16 February at 19:49. [6]

RankLaneNameNationalityTimeNotes
Gold medal icon.svg4 Tes Schouten Flag of the Netherlands.svg  Netherlands 2:19.81
Silver medal icon.svg5 Kate Douglass Flag of the United States.svg  United States 2:20.91
Bronze medal icon.svg3 Sydney Pickrem Flag of Canada (Pantone).svg  Canada 2:22.94
46 Alina Zmushka World Aquatics logomark 2.svg Neutral Independent Athletes 2:24.44
51 Mona McSharry Flag of Ireland.svg  Ireland 2:24.89
68 Kristýna Horská Flag of the Czech Republic.svg  Czech Republic 2:25.34
77 Gabrielle Assis Flag of Brazil.svg  Brazil 2:25.66
82 Lisa Mamié Flag of Switzerland (Pantone).svg   Switzerland 2:26.23
